## **R I D I N G  S C H O O L A H M A D ' S  S T O R Y  -** 

A h m a d  i s  1 6  y e a r s o l d  a n d  o r i g i n a l l y f r o m  S y r i a .  H i s  f a m i l y l e f t  S y r i a  d u e  t o  t h e w a r  a n d  A h m a d  c a m e t o  t h e  F r i e n d s h i p C a f é  a s  a  y o u n g  p e r s o n a t  t h e  y o u t h  c l u b  a n d p u t  h i m s e l f  f o r w a r d  a s s o m e o n e  w h o  c o u l d  h e l p 

r e p a i r  a n d  m a i n t a i n  b i k e s  a s  a  v o l u n t e e r . H e  a l w a y s  w a n t e d  t o  r i d e  b u t  t h e r e  w a s  a  b i g w a i t i n g  l i s t  s o  a f t e r  w a i t i n g  t h r e e  y e a r s ,  h i s 

o p p o r t u n i t y  c a m e  u p  l a s t  y e a r  a n d  h e  h a s  b e e n  l e a r n i n g  a n d v o l u n t e e r i n g  a t  t h e  s a m e  t i m e .  A h m a d  i s  w o r k i n g  t o w a r d s  h i s  B r i t i s h H o r s e  S o c i e t y  ‘ R i d i n g  C e n t r e  A s s i s t a n t  A w a r d ’  a n d  h a s  a l s o  b e e n o f f e r e d  a  f u l l y  s p o n s o r e d  1  w e e k  p l a c e m e n t  a t  t h e  B r i t i s h  R a c i n g S c h o o l  i n  N e w m a r k e t  i n  A u g u s t  t h i s  y e a r .  A t  t h e  C o r o n a t i o n v o l u n t e e r i n g  e v e n t  h e l d  a t  t h e  C a t h e d r a l ,  A h m a d  s p o k e  t o  H R H  T h e P r i n c e s s  R o y a l  a b o u t  h i s  p a s s i o n  f o r  h o r s e s  a n d  h i s  v o l u n t e e r i n g , a n d  w a s  i n t e r v i e w e d  b y  B i s h o p  R a c h e l ,  t h e  B B C  a n d  I T V . 

A  n u m b e r  o f  t h e  c h i l d r e n  w h o  l e a r n t  t o r i d e  w i t h  u s  n o w  w o r k  i n  t h e  e q u e s t r i a n i n d u s t r y  a s  a p p r e n t i c e  j o c k e y s ,  g r o o m s a n d  r i d i n g  s c h o o l  s t a f f .

U n r e f l e c t e d  R e f l e c t i o n s  i s  a n  a r c h i v a l  a n d c r e a t i v e  p r o j e c t  c e l e b r a t i n g  t h e  M u s l i m c o m m u n i t i e s  i n  G l o u c e s t e r  a n d  t h e i r s i g n i f i c a n t  c o n t r i b u t i o n  t o  G l o u c e s t e r s h i r e  a n d m o r e  w i d e l y . 

T h i s  v i d e o  p r o j e c t  f o l l o w s  o n  f r o m  t h e  U n t o l d S e r i e s  ( 2 0 0 3 )  o f  b o o k s  a n d  t h e  H i s t o r y  o f M u s l i m s  i n  G l o u c e s t e r  ( 2 0 0 8 )  b o o k l e t  t o p r o v i d e  a  g l i m p s e  i n t o  t h e  h i s t o r y  a n d n a r r a t i v e  o f  M u s l i m  c o m m u n i t i e s  i n G l o u c e s t e r . 

T h e  n a r r a t i v e  a n d  d i r e c t i o n  o f  t h e  w o r k  w a s  t o p r o d u c e  s o m e t h i n g  c r e a t i v e  a n d  v i s u a l  t o s h o w c a s e  s o m e  a s p e c t s  o f  t h e  c o m m u n i t y  a n d t h e i r  i n f l u e n c e . 

O n e  o f  t h e  k e y  f a c t o r s  a n d  d r i v e r s  f o r  t h i s  p r o j e c t  i s  t h a t  w e  a r e r a p i d l y  l o s i n g  t h e  f i r s t  g e n e r a t i o n  o f  m i g r a n t s ,  a n d  w i t h  t h e m  t h e i r s t o r i e s  a r e  a l s o  l o s t  a n d  u n c a p t u r e d .  W e  w a n t  t o  t a k e  t h i s o p p o r t u n i t y  n o w  a n d  m a k e  a  s t a r t  i n  g a t h e r i n g  a s  m u c h  o f  t h i s  r i c h h i s t o r y  b e f o r e  w e  l o s e  t h o s e  w h o  a r e  p r e s e n t ,  a n d  o u r  f u t u r e g e n e r a t i o n  a r e  a t  a  l o s s  i n  u n d e r s t a n d i n g  a n d  v a l u i n g  t h e i r  a n c e s t r y . 

W e  l a u n c h e d  t h e  f i r s t  2  i n i t i a t i v e s  i n  2 0 2 2 ,  o n e  w a s  a  p h o t o g r a p h y e x h i b i t i o n  o f  p e o p l e ,  p l a c e s  a n d  s t o r i e s  c a l l e d  -  ' T h r o u g h  t h e  L e n s ' w o r k i n g  w i t h  t h e  U n i  o f  G l o u c e s t e r s h i r e  a n d  s e c o n d l y ,  w a s  t h e  l a u n c h o f  a  M u s l i m - l e d  d o c u m e n t a r y  c a l l e d  '  G l o u c e s t e r ' s  G l o r y ' .  T o  d a t e  w e h a v e  h a d  1 2  s h o w i n g s ,  r a n g i n g  f r o m  C o m m u n i t y  l a u n c h ,  G l o u c e s t e r H i s t o r y  f e s t i v a l ,  s c h o o l s ,  U n i v e r s i t i e s  a n d  t h e  N H S . 

F o l l o w i n g  t h e  t h e  f i r s t  i n i t i a t i v e ,  M a n y  c o m m u n i t y  m e m b e r s  h a v e c o m e  f o r w a r d  a n d  a s k e d  f o r  m o r e  s t o r i e s  t o  b e  t o l d  a n d  c a p t u r e d . H o p e f u l l y  w e  p l a n  t o  p r o d u c e  m o r e  f i l m s  i n  2 0 2 3 .

## **C O O K ,  S P E A K  &  E A T** 

' C o o k  S p e a k  E a t ’  i s  a b o u t  c u l i n a r y e d u c a t i o n  a n d  c u l t u r a l  s h a r i n g . 

E v e r y  w e e k  a  g r o u p  o f  l a d i e s  m e e t a n d  c o o k  a  d i s h  f r o m  o n e  o f  t h e i r h o m e  c o u n t r i e s ,  s p e a k  a b o u t  i t  i n E n g l i s h  a n d  e a t  i t  t o g e t h e r . 

L e d  b y  S u s a n  H e p b u r n ,  t h e  c l a s s h a s  1 3  n a t i o n a l i t i e s  s o  e v e r y o n e  i s e n c o u r a g e d  t o  s p e a k  E n g l i s h , p r o v i d i n g  a  g r e a t  o p p o r t u n i t y  t o p r a c t i c e  E n g l i s h  c o n v e r s a t i o n , p r o n u n c i a t i o n  a n d  v o c a b u l a r y . 

I t  i s  a l s o  s u p p o r t s  w e l l b e i n g  a n d  g o o d  m e n t a l  h e a l t h ,  g i v i n g e v e r y o n e  a  c h a n c e  t o  b e  v i s i b l e ,  s h o w c a s e  s k i l l s  a n d  l e a r n  n e w o n e s ,  a s  w e l l  a s  p r o v i d i n g  t h e  n u r t u r i n g  a s p e c t  o f  s i t t i n g  a t  a  t a b l e t o g e t h e r  a n d  e n j o y i n g  d e l i c i o u s  f o o d  t h a t  o u r  l e a r n e r s  m a y  n o t  h a v e e a t e n  s i n c e  t h e y  a r r i v e d  i n  t h e  U K . 

' C u r r e n t l y ,  m o s t  p a r t i c i p a n t s  a r e w o m e n  n e w  t o  t h e  c o u n t r y  b u t ,  i n 

t h e  f u t u r e ,  w e  h o p e  t o  r u n  t h i s p r o j e c t  o u t  t o  i n c l u d e  a n y o n e  f r o m t h e  l o c a l  c o m m u n i t y  a n d  m e n . '  s a y s 

S u s a n  ' W e  l o v e  u s i n g  d i f f e r e n t c o m m u n i t y  s p a c e s  a s  w e l l  a s  t h e k i t c h e n  t o  l e a r n  i n ,  w e  o f t e n  c o o k i n  t h e  c o m m u n i t y  a l l o t m e n t . 

O u r  l e a r n e r s  a r e  w o r k i n g  t o w a r d s t h e i r  L e v e l  2  f o o d  h y g i e n e c e r t i f i c a t e s  a n d  w e  a r e  g i v i n g  t h e m c o m m e r c i a l  e x p e r i e n c e  t h r o u g h c a f e  t a k e o v e r s  a n d  a  f a r m e r s ’ m a r k e t  s t a l l .  I t ’ s  a  g r e a t  p r o j e c t a n d  w e  a r e  a l l  v e r y  p r o u d  o f  i t ' .
